I cannot remove the stump pan from the center section of a 315 bushhog (need to replace seals). I have tried everything including ideas from this site. I wanted to know if I remove the 6 bolts on the bottom of the gearbox and then lift off the main part of the gearbox, could I take off the nut on the top of the output shaft and let the shaft, lower bearing and stump pan fall out the bottom? Then I think I could separate the pan. Thanks.

we have two of the 2615 mowers and i have had to cut the stump jumper too get in there it a added $to the job but sometimes it the only way
